Situation
Background InformationZargabad sits as the main passage point through the hilly region, with an MSR running North to South. We are to clear the town and it's adjacent military bases to support operations beyond the area. 5th team member for all teams will be unlocked if ORBAT is filled Mortar teams will use M1129 120mm Mortar Carriers
Friendly Forces
VOODOO Platoon with 2 rifle squads and 1 Weapon Team Supported by : ARCHER Stryker Mortar Section SPIRIT Logistics Team
Supporting Assets
Motor transport for insert and reinforcements Air Assets providing CAP in the area
Enemy Forces
Royal Army Corps of Sahrani, operating Western equipment Large infantry presence with dug in positions and strongholds. The city has been eveacuated of all civilians and is used as extensive defensive position. Mechanised and Heavy Armor platoons are operating from the military bases and are expected to be encountered on the outskirts of the city or as reinforcements.
Mission
TaskingEliminate the entrenched enemy and clear MSR GOLD to provide a corridor through the city.
End-state
Friendly positions set along MSR Gold. ALL CALLSIGNS regrouped.
Execution
Commander's IntentThe intent of this operation is to remove RACS presence in and around Zargabad, in particular the known enemy positions marked by intelligence staff at HQ. As with all city clearance/ heavy MOUT terrain, all elements must be ready and willing to adapt to changing circumstances and taskings.
Tasks and Sequencing
Phase 0: Transit and organisation. The platoon will be escorted by Strykers from an attached company for our initial transit to PLT WP1. Upon arrival at Shahbaz, logistics and indirect fire elements will set up an LRP for the first phase of the operation. Infantry will mount trucks assigned during the briefing- each Voodoo infantry element will travel in a transport truck each and will man the vehicles themselves. Voodoo 3 has the option of retaining their vehicle for transit between vantage points later in the mission. Platoon Sgt will organise initial route though first transit is expected to be short and simple. Phase 1: Clearance of Sectors 1-3 and the South CP. Sec 1 is a RACS military base. Under cover of Voodoo 3, Voodoo 1 + 2 will bound over to the West side of Sector 1 and begin pushing through. For the FOB itself one squad will enter with the other on security, to be decided at the time. Voodoo 3 may set up positions around a small cluster of hills at V3 OP1 or anywhere they decide provides better positioning to cover friendly elements crossing to Sec 1. After Sec 1, we will likely use cover of foliage between Sec 1 and 2 to approach Yarum. Once Yarum is clear, LOGPAK if needed then transition to the East side of the city for the main sweep. Voodoo 3 are to continue utilising any advantageous positions to provide weapon support to the platoon. Highpoints which may be useful are numbered throughout the city by intelligence staff. Phase 2: Sectors 4-7 and East Barracks. Beginning in Sec 4 and 5, the platoon will begin our sweep of the city proper. The East Barracks is the primary enemy position expected in Phase 2; however, whilst the city is clear of civilians the enemy has been setting up fortified structures. We expect many structures to be empty and the enemy focusing on defending key fortified structures- these will be the focus of clearing efforts as we push East to West through Zargabad. Phase 2 ends once the city East of MSR Gold is swept. Phase 3: Sectors 8-13 and optionally sector 14. West Barracks and Airfield are key positions in this phase. Continued city clearance by sector West of MSR Gold, assigned based on positioning and pace. Mosque which includes Highpoint 6 is empty of civilians and may be used by the enemy as a defensible position. We do not expect any enemy attack aircraft from the airfield so it may not be heavily defended. We will decide based upon recce whether we should take it as a platoon or with 1 squad. Phase 4: Optional phase for stretch objectives to the North of the city. Alternately, we will find fixed positions in the city and hold against any counter-attack. The stretch objectives include Sectors 15-16, North CP and Roden HQ. Transit to these positions will be requisitioned through Spirit 4.
